MongoDB Development Company

Enhance MongoDB Developmentwith Offshore Experts

MongoDB development solutions we offer

Custom MongoDB Development

We design and implement custom MongoDB solutions for mobile, e-commerce, and IoT apps. Our focus is on high performance.

MongoDB Database Design

By using MongoDB Compass and Atlas, we ensure efficient database designs. These are tailored to meet your application's specific needs.

MEAN Stack Development

The MEAN stack allows us to develop high-performance apps. We use a unified JavaScript language to streamline development and flexibility.

Developing RESTful APIs

Our MongoDB and Node.js solutions create robust back-end systems. We design APIs to ensure smooth communication between applications and systems.

MongoDB Performance Optimization

Using tools like MongoDB Atlas and Robo 3T, we monitor and optimize performance. This helps identify bottlenecks and improve efficiency.

Integrating MongoDB

Our MongoDB integration solutions connect with frameworks and analytics tools, including Node.js and PowerBI. This enhances app performance and functionality.

Why Choose Mediusware for MongoDB Development?

Top 1% of Tech Experts

Our MongoDB developers are part of the top 1% of tech talent.

With a deep understanding of the database's core principles and vast hands-on experience, they excel at building robust, high-performance applications using MongoDB.

Secure Software

Security is a top priority in our MongoDB development process. We leverage the database's built-in security features, including encryption, access control, and audit trails, while implementing additional protective measures.

Strict NDAs are also enforced to ensure the confidentiality of your data.

Tailored Software Solutions

We have extensive experience creating tailored software solutions.

MongoDB's flexibility allows us to build everything from mobile, web, and IoT applications to e-commerce platforms and social networks, all tailored to meet your unique business needs.

The mongodb ecosystem we’ve leveraged in past projects

Development and Integration Frameworks

Facilitate application and service development directly interfacing with MongoDB, providing object modeling and seamless integration capabilities.

  • Spring Data MongoDB
  • Mongoose
  • MongoEngine
  • Meteor
  • Morphia
  • Pymodm
  • Mongoid

Data Management and Visualization Tools

Graphical interfaces for managing, visualizing, and interacting with MongoDB databases, simplifying administrative tasks.

  • Robo 3T (formerly Robomongo)
  • MongoDB Compass
  • Studio 3T

Monitoring and Optimization Tools

Track performance, identify bottlenecks, and automate database management to enhance efficiency and scalability.

  • Ops Manager
  • MongoDB Atlas
  • mongostat
  • mongotop
  • MongoDB Exporter
  • Prometheus with MongoDB Exporter

Deployment, Scaling, and DevOps Tools

Support deployment, scaling, and operational management in containerized and traditional server environments.

  • Kubernetes
  • Docker
  • Terraform
  • Ansible
  • Transporter

Data Migration and Backup Tools

Facilitate migration to MongoDB from other systems, as well as backup and restoration for data integrity and availability.

  • Mongify
  • Mongodump
  • Mongorestore
  • Fongo
  • Mockgoose

Search Integration and Enhanced Functionality

Extend MongoDB capabilities with advanced search integration and additional functionalities.

  • Mongoosastic
  • Elasticsearch
  • MongoDB Connector for Elasticsearch

Testing and Development Tools

Utilities and libraries to improve development efficiency, testing, and shell interactions.

  • mongo-hacker
  • mongorc.js

Essential facts to know about mongodb

Scalability

MongoDB is built for scalability, with features like sharding and replication that allow it to handle high traffic and large datasets. This makes it ideal for modern applications that need to manage increasing amounts of data and users, such as big data applications.

Flexible Document Model

One of MongoDB's key strengths is its flexible document model. Instead of using rigid tabular schemas, MongoDB stores data in BSON documents, supporting various data types and formats. This flexibility accelerates development and enhances adaptability to evolving business needs.

Performance

MongoDB is a high-performance NoSQL database designed to handle high traffic and large data volumes. With features like document-oriented storage, indexing, sharding, replication, and efficient storage of large objects, MongoDB ensures optimized performance for data-intensive applications.

Digital. Outcomes. Delivered.

Initial discovery call

We start by understanding your business, specific requirements, goals, timeline, and budget. We’ll also discuss the specialized skills you need for the MongoDB development project.

Team setup and roadmap creation

We’ll assemble a team with the required expertise and assign a project manager to ensure your MongoDB development stays on track. We then create a detailed roadmap and select the right resources to help you achieve your objectives.

Project implementation and monitoring

Once the team is onboarded, we begin work. While we operate independently, we will keep you informed with regular updates. You’ll have the flexibility to scale the project or make changes as necessary throughout the development process.

Frequently Asked Questions

Hiring dedicated MongoDB developers provides several advantages, including access to specialized expertise in designing and managing NoSQL databases. You can choose to collaborate with an outsourcing team for a specific MongoDB development project or establish an ongoing partnership for continuous support and development.

Beyond this: 100+ More Technology we have

Let's
Talk